Advertisement

基于Python和MySQL的成绩与学生信息管理系统

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本系统是一款采用Python编程语言及MySQL数据库构建的学生成绩与个人信息管理工具。它为学校管理者提供了一个高效、便捷的数据处理平台,支持学生成绩录入、查询以及维护学生档案等功能。 建立一个小型的成绩管理系统数据库,使用Python和MySQL语言实现。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• PythonMySQL
    优质
    本系统是一款采用Python编程语言及MySQL数据库构建的学生成绩与个人信息管理工具。它为学校管理者提供了一个高效、便捷的数据处理平台,支持学生成绩录入、查询以及维护学生档案等功能。 建立一个小型的成绩管理系统数据库,使用Python和MySQL语言实现。
  • SSM、MySQLJSP
    优质
    本系统为高校学生管理设计,采用SSM框架及MySQL数据库技术开发,界面使用JSP实现。功能涵盖成绩录入查询、个人信息维护等,提高教务工作效率。 系统介绍 该系统的功能包括: 学生: - 首页 - 个人中心 - 课程信息 - 成绩信息系统管理员: - 首页 - 学生信息 - 课程信息 - 成绩信息 运行环境:idea+mysql8.0
  • PythonTkinter
    优质
    本系统是一款基于Python语言及Tkinter库开发的学生学业成绩管理工具,提供直观界面便于教师录入、查询与统计学生考试成绩。 基于Python+Tkinter的学生成绩信息管理系统具备以下功能:1、添加学生成绩信息;2、删除学生成绩信息;3、修改学生成绩信息;4、查询学生成绩信息;5、对学生成绩进行排序;6、用户添加;7、修改用户权限;8、更改用户密码;9、系统登录界面;10、退出系统。
  • JSPServlet(Mysql)
    优质
    本系统是一款基于JSP与Servlet技术开发的学生成绩管理系统,采用MySQL数据库进行数据存储。它为教师提供便捷的成绩录入、查询及管理功能,旨在提高教学行政效率并保障信息安全。 学生选课信息管理系统采用JSP技术开发完成,并附带了详细的毕业论文,适合用于毕业设计项目。作为Sun Microsystems公司主导创建的一种动态网页标准,JavaServer Pages(JSP)能够部署在网络服务器上以响应客户端的请求,根据请求内容生成HTML、XML等格式的文档并返回给用户。此外,JSP技术使用Java语言编写脚本,并能与其他Java程序协同处理复杂的业务需求。
  • PythonSqlite数据库
    优质
    本项目开发了一套学生信息与成绩管理系统,采用Python语言结合SQLite数据库技术,实现了学生数据的有效存储、查询及管理功能。 基本信息管理和学生成绩管理是两个主要模块。基本信息管理模块的主要功能包括学生信息的添加、删除、修改、显示以及学生数据的导入导出;而学生成绩管理模块则负责统计课程最高分、最低分和平均分。
  • Java+Swing+MySQL选课
    优质
    本系统是一款基于Java和Swing开发,并结合MySQL数据库支持的学生选课与成绩管理系统。它为学生提供便捷的课程选择服务及成绩查询功能,同时帮助教师和管理员轻松进行课程管理和学生成绩维护。 该系统包括学生教师信息管理、年级班级信息管理和课程信息管理等功能,并支持选课及成绩录入与统计功能。此外,还实现了学生、教师和管理员三个角色的登录机制,涉及到的知识点有数据库操作(增删改查)以及Java Swing界面编程等技术。 主菜单分为开始菜单、后台管理、选课情况、成绩管理和帮助五大模块。其中: - 开始菜单包括重新登录、修改密码、用户管理、操作日志和初始化数据库等功能; - 后台管理则涵盖学生信息管理、教师信息管理、课程信息管理以及年级与班级的信息管理功能。
  • PythonMySQL).rar
    优质
    本资源为一个实用的Python项目,旨在教授如何开发学生成绩管理系统。该系统利用Python语言结合MySQL数据库技术,实现成绩录入、查询及管理功能,适合学习Python应用开发和数据库操作的学生使用。 使用 Python 自带的 tkinter 库实现基于 MySQL 的简单图形化学生信息管理系统,具备简单的访问控制、账号管理、账号协作、统计计算、数据可视化以及数据库数据的导入导出功能,并支持对数据表内容进行增删改查操作。在本地安装好 MySQL 后即可打开使用。
  • 优质
    学生成绩与信息管理系统是一款专为教育机构设计的应用程序,它能够高效地管理学生的个人信息、课程安排以及成绩记录,极大提升了教学管理和评估工作的便捷性和准确性。 学生管理系统采用Access和NetBeans进行开发。
  • 优质
    学生成绩与信息管理系统是一款专为学校设计的应用程序,旨在高效管理学生档案、课程安排及成绩记录,助力教育机构提升工作效率和教学质量。 在使用学生信息管理系统之前,请先根据该目录下的“系统部署流程”搭建运行环境。完成系统部署后,启动Wamp服务器,并确保所有服务均已启动。然后,在浏览器中输入地址:http://localhost:8080/qingkong/ 进入系统。 目前仅设置了一个用户账户: 账号:000001 密码:123456 登录时选择您想要访问的学生页面或教师页面,填写信息后点击“登录”即可进入系统。在界面右上角可以找到退出功能;左侧的菜单栏内有各个功能模块,请根据需要点击相应的按钮进行操作。
  • 优质
    学生成绩与信息管理系统是一款专为教育机构设计的应用程序,旨在实现学生学业成绩、个人信息等数据的高效管理。通过该系统,教师和管理人员能够便捷地录入、查询及分析各类学术数据,从而有效提升教学质量和行政效率。 《基于C语言与SQLite的学生信息管理系统详解》 在信息技术领域,数据管理是核心任务之一,在教育行业尤其重要。本段落将深入探讨一款利用C语言编程和SQLite数据库技术实现的学生信息管理系统,并阐述其设计原理、功能实现及应用价值。 一、基础概述 C语言作为经典且高效的编程语言,因其简洁明了的语法和强大的系统级操作能力,常被用于开发底层软件。SQLite则是一款轻量级的嵌入式数据库,它无需单独服务器进程即可在应用程序内部运行,并提供了丰富的SQL接口,适合处理小型到中型的数据存储需求。 二、系统架构设计 学生信息管理系统主要包含用户界面、数据存取、数据处理以及错误处理等模块: 1. 用户界面:C语言通过标准输入输出(stdio)实现简单的命令行界面,支持信息的添加、修改、查询和删除操作。 2. 数据存取:利用SQLite API执行SQL语句进行数据库读写操作。 3. 数据处理:根据用户的指令对数据进行筛选、排序及统计等操作。 4. 错误处理:具备良好的错误报告机制,在遇到非法输入或数据库操作失败时,能够提供清晰的反馈并恢复程序正常运行。 三、功能实现 1. 学生信息添加 2. 通过INSERT语句将新学生的各项数据存储至“student”表。 3. 修改学生记录 4. 根据学号等唯一标识符更新相应字段。 5. 查询学生资料 6. 支持模糊或精确查询,返回匹配结果集。 7. 删除学生信息 8. 使用DELETE语句根据用户选择的学号移除对应记录。 9. 数据备份与恢复 系统能够将数据库文件(如“student_db”)复制到其他位置以防止数据丢失,并支持从备份中还原数据。 四、优势分析 1. 高度灵活:C语言特性使该系统能在内存管理和控制方面更加自由高效; 2. 资源占用低:SQLite体积小,硬件需求少,在各种环境中运行良好。 3. 扩展性强 4. 便于添加成绩管理等功能模块。 5. 数据安全可靠 五、应用前景 学生信息管理系统被广泛应用于学校教务部门中,简化了管理工作流程并提高了工作效率。未来结合云计算和大数据等先进技术后可实现远程访问及数据分析功能,进一步提高服务质量与管理水平。 总结而言,《基于C语言与SQLite的学生信息管理系统》是一个高效实用的解决方案,在传统编程技术基础上融合现代数据库技术实现了对学生资料的有效管理。随着教育信息化步伐加快,此类系统将在更大范围内发挥作用并为教育领域带来更多的便利性。